Enantiomers of amino-phenyl-acetic acid octadec-9-(z) enyl ester, their salts and their uses

Disclosed are enantiomers of amino-phenyl-acetic acid octadec-9-(Z)-enyl ester, and salts thereof, including pharmaceutical compositions, uses and a process for the manufacture thereof.
Use of long-chain alcohol derivatives for the treatment of alopecia areata

Disclosed is a method of treating alopecia greata using a compound having the formula: wherein R1 is C10-C24 alkenyl; R2 is H, C1-C6 alkyl, aryl, or aralkyl, where any aryl moiety may be unsubstituted or substituted by nitro, cyano, halo, hydroxyl, NR6R7, or CR8R8NR6R7, where R6, R7, and R8 each independently is H or C1-C6 alkyl; and R3 and R4 each independently is H or C1-C6 alkyl, or R3 and R4 together with the nitrogen atom to which they are attached form a 5-7 membered heterocyclic saturated ring optionally containing an additional N or O, which is unsubstituted or substituted by C1-C6 alkyl, or an enantiomer or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t of the compound.
